How to Identify a Safe Online Link
Checking a link before using it is a simple but effective digital habit. Users can follow basic steps to improve their online safety.
First, review the website address carefully. Fake websites often use unusual spellings, extra words, or unfamiliar domain names to appear similar to legitimate platforms.
Second, avoid entering passwords, banking information, or private details on websites that do not appear trustworthy.
Third, research the website reputation through reliable sources. Reading reviews and checking website history can help users make better decisions.
Common Risks Associated With Unknown Links
Unknown links can create several online security concerns. Some common risks include:
Phishing Attempts
Phishing websites are designed to imitate real platforms and trick users into sharing sensitive information. These pages may request usernames, passwords, verification codes, or payment details.
Malware and Unsafe Downloads
Some links may redirect users to pages that promote harmful downloads. Installing unknown files can put devices at risk.
Data Privacy Issues
Websites with unclear privacy policies may collect user information without proper transparency. Users should always understand what data a website collects before using its services.
Tips for Safer Browsing
Safe browsing habits can protect users from many online threats. Always verify links before clicking, keep browsers updated, use strong passwords, and enable additional security features whenever possible.
Users should also avoid opening links received from unknown messages, suspicious emails, or unreliable sources. A few seconds of checking can prevent major security problems.
